STAMFORD HIGH SCHOOL - STAMFORD, CT

Data Source:

School NameAddressPhoneGradesCountyTypeDistrict Name
Stamford High School55 Strawberry Hill Ave
Stamford, CT 06902
(203) 977-42279-12FairfieldpublicStamford School District

Ethnic BackgroundPercentYear
White, non-Hispanic42.47892009
Black, non-Hispanic25.93262009
Hispanic25.87242009
Asian/Pacific Islander5.7162009

Students per TeacherYear
13.32009

Students Getting Free LunchYear
41%2009
